Just in case you do not realize. The reason for this is because it basically includes all new air conditioning controls. I searched a Crutchfield, and Ebay and the cheapest I found was $265. Still a lot but I can understand the price as it is not just a plastic trim kit. Let this generation get a few more years under its belt and I am sure the price will come down but I doubt it will ever be much less that $150
